区块链在溯源过程中如何确保数据的不可篡改性?
区块链在数据溯源过程中,确保数据的不可篡改性是其核心特性之一,这种特性归功于其独特的设计和架构。每个区块包含大量数据,并且通过加密技术与上一个区块进行连接,形成一个链条。每个区块都有自己的哈希值,该值是基于区块内所有数据生成的。任何对区块内容的修改,都会引起哈希值的改变,进而影响到后续所有区块的哈希值。这种关联性确保了数据一旦被记录,就无法轻易篡改。通过这种方式,一旦数据进入区块链,它就像是被锁在一个永恒的保险箱中,任何试图改变数据的行为都会被整条链条中的哈希校验所及时发现。
现有的区块链通常采用分布式网络架构,各参与节点都存储有相同的区块链副本。当数据被添加到链中后,各节点会对新数据进行验证。验证成功后,这些数据才会被正式记录到区块链中。通过这种共识机制,只有在大多数节点达成一致之后,新的数据才能加入链中,这种设计也就提升了数据的安全性。任何单一节点无法单独控制链上数据的修改,这使得恶意篡改的难度大大增加。
时间戳也在确保数据不可篡改性中占有重要地位。每个区块都带有时间戳,用于记录数据被添加的确切时间。这不仅提升了数据的可靠性,还使得追溯的每一步都有明确的时间证据。一旦数据被记录,和之前区块的时间戳形成了不可更改的时间序列,这在进一步的审计和核查中极具价值。
加密技术为数据的安全提供了额外的层次。区块链上存储的数据通常通过密码学算法进行加密,只有拥有特定密钥的人才能访问和解密这些数据。这种加密形式有效防止了外部未授权访问和篡改。即便某个区域的节点生出了恶意行为,数据的加密也可以确保除了授权用户外,其他人无法解读数据的真实性,未授权的修改也同样会被拒绝。
智能合约的引入进一步增强了区块链系统的能力。智能合约是自动执行的协议,能够根据特定条件触发特定操作。通过智能合约,数据处理的自动化和透明度得到了提升,所有交易的执行及记录都在区块链上进行,确保了事务的一致性和透明性。这意味着,所有当时的交易和状态信息都会受到区块链的保护,同样不可被篡改。
参与区块链网络的用户对数据共享和处理有着共同的法规遵循。在进行信息更新时,如果有一方试图插入不符合协议的信息,网络中的其他用户会迅速识别并对其否决。这种分布式审计的机制,确保了信息的真实可靠,也降低了对中心化监控的需求,促使所有数据在共同监督中保持一致性。
在供链管理、农产品追踪等领域,区块链技术的应用显得尤为重要。通过在区块链上记录从原材料采购、生产、运输到零售的每一个环节,所有相关数据都透明且可追溯。当消费者利用区块链查看产品信息时,他们可以确信这些信息是不会被篡改的,有效保障了其消费选择的真实性和安全感。
保持数据不可篡改性的关键在于技术设计、网络架构以及安全机制共同作用的结果。数据在区块链上的全过程都是由一系列保护措施支持的,从数据的记录、存储到审计的经营,确保了数据的完整性和安全性。
ChainSafeAI(链熵科技)专注于区块链生态安全,以“数据驱动 + 技术赋能”构建360°全方位安全防护体系,服务于交易所、金融机构、OTC服务商及加密资产投资者。公司提供覆盖KYT风险监测、智能合约审计、加密资产追踪、区块链漏洞测试等在内的全维度安全与合规技术解决方案,助力客户防范洗钱、诈骗等风险,保障业务合规运行。通过实时风险预警、合规审查与资金溯源分析,协助客户识别链上异常行为、防范洗钱及诈骗风险、降低被盗损失并提升资产追回可能性。